cis-4-(Piperazin-1-yl)-5,6,7a,8,9,10,11,11a-octahydrobenzofuro[2,3-h]quinazolin-2-amine, 4 (A-987306) is a new histamine H-4 antagonist. The compound is potent in H-4 receptor binding assays (rat H-4, K-i = 3.4 nM, human H-4 K-i = 5.8 nM) and demonstrated potent functional antagonism in vitro at human, rat, and mouse H-4 receptors in cell-based FLIPR assays. Compound 4 also demonstrated H-4 antagonism in vivo in mice, blocking H-4-agonist induced scratch responses, and showed anti-inflammatory activity in mice in a peritonitis model. Most interesting was the high potency and efficacy of this compound in blocking pain responses, where it showed an ED50 of 42 mu mol/kg (ip) in a rat post-carrageenan thermal hyperalgesia model of inflammatory pain.
